下载此文档

多目标动态规划算法的泛化性能定量化.docx


文档分类:论文 | 页数:约24页 举报非法文档有奖
1/24
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/24 下载此文档
文档列表 文档介绍
该【多目标动态规划算法的泛化性能定量化 】是由【科技星球】上传分享,文档一共【24】页,该文档可以免费在线阅读,需要了解更多关于【多目标动态规划算法的泛化性能定量化 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。1/30多目标动态规划算法的泛化性能定量化第一部分多目标动态规划算法概述 2第二部分泛化性能度量标准制定 4第三部分泛化性能定量化方法分析 8第四部分影响泛化性能的关键因素研究 10第五部分泛化性能与算法参数关系探究 12第六部分不同数据集泛化性能比较 14第七部分泛化性能优化策略讨论 17第八部分多目标动态规划算法泛化性能未来展望 202/30第一部分多目标动态规划算法概述关键词关键要点主题名称::涉及多个目标函数,目标之间可能存在竞争或冲突关系,决策过程需要同时考虑所有目标。:将多目标问题分解为一系列子问题,通过递推求解的方式逐步优化所有目标。:状态定义、状态转移方程、效用函数设计、决策变量求解、最优解追溯。主题名称:泛化能力评估多目标动态规划算法概述引言多目标动态规划(MODP)算法是一种数学优化技术,用于解决具有多个、相互冲突的目标的复杂决策问题。与经典的动态规划不同,MODP算法可以同时优化多个目标,从而为决策者提供更全面的解决方案。动态规划回顾动态规划是一种自底向上的方法,用于优化问题,其子问题具有重叠性。其关键思想是将问题分解成一系列子问题,然后通过递归求解这些子问题,逐步建立问题的整体最优解。多目标优化多目标优化问题涉及同时优化多个目标函数。与单目标优化不同,多目标优化问题可能不存在单一的、明确的最优解。相反,通常以帕累托最优解集的形式存在一系列可接受的解决方案。多目标动态规划算法MODP算法将动态规划与多目标优化相结合,以解决多目标决策问题。3/30其基本过程如下:*分解问题:将问题分解成一系列重叠的子问题。*定义状态和决策:定义问题状态空间和允许的决策。*递归计算:对于每个状态,使用多目标优化算法计算考虑所有决策后的帕累托最优动作集。*记忆化:将计算出的帕累托最优动作集存储在一个表格中,以避免重复计算。*反向跟踪:从问题结束状态开始,通过反向跟踪表格中的动作,获得整体帕累托最优解集。MODP算法的类型存在多种MODP算法,每种算法都有不同的特点:*加权和法:将目标函数加权平均,形成一个单一的目标函数进行优化。*ε-约束法:将其中一个目标函数优化为主要目标,其他目标函数作为约束条件。*层次分析法(AHP):将问题分解成一个层次结构,逐层比较不同目标和决策的权重。*偏好启发式搜索(PHS):使用启发式搜索算法在目标空间中探索解决方案,并根据决策者的偏好选择最终解。应用MODP算法广泛应用于各种领域,包括:*资源分配:优化资源分配,以满足多个相互竞争的需求。4/30*投资组合优化:构建多元化的投资组合,以实现风险和回报之间的平衡。*供应链管理:协调供应链的各个方面,以同时优化成本、效率和客户满意度。优点*同时优化多个目标,提供更全面的解决方案。*考虑目标之间的权衡取舍,以满足决策者的偏好。*通过记忆化和有效的多目标优化算法,提高计算效率。局限性*对于具有大量目标和决策的大型问题,计算复杂度可能很高。*需要决策者清晰地定义目标和权重,这在实际情况中可能具有挑战性。*帕累托最优解集的大小和多样性可能会受到目标数量和问题复杂度的影响。:验证集样本与训练集样本完全独立,互不重叠,避免训练集分布偏差影响评估。:验证集样本应充分代表目标任务分布,包含训练集中没有覆盖的数据多样性。:验证集规模应足够大以提供可靠的性能估计,但也不宜过大,以免消耗过多计算资源。:衡量算法预测值与真实值之间的接近程度,5/30如准确率、召回率、F1值。:衡量算法对数据扰动、噪声或分布变化的敏感性,如交叉验证得分、曲线下面积。:衡量算法的计算复杂度和时间消耗,如运行时间、内存使用情况。:包括不同类型和性能水平的算法,为算法性能提供参考点。:确保基准算法在相同的训练和测试条件下进行评估,避免不公正的比较。:使用统计检验(如t检验、卡方检验)验证算法性能差异的显著性,提高评估结果的可信度。:通过添加噪声或扰动训练数据,评估算法对数据质量的影响。:使用不同分布的数据集测试算法,评估其对分布差异的适应性。:探索算法对超参数设置的敏感性,确定最佳参数组合。:使用模型解释技术(如特征重要性、决策树可视化)理解算法的决策过程。:分析算法预测中是否存在偏差或不公平现象,确保算法的公平性和可信度。:与领域专家合作验证算法输出的合理性和可解释性,提高算法的可信度。:将元学****算法应用于多目标动态规划,提高算法对新任务的适应能力。:探索强化学****技术在多目标动态规划中的应用,提升算法的学****效率和决策质量。:将神经网络集成到多目标动态规划算法中,提升算法的非线性拟合能力和鲁棒性。泛化性能度量标准制定泛化性能衡量多目标动态规划(MODP)算法在未知或不同环境下的适应性。制定合适的度量标准至关重要,有助于算法的比较和改进。6/30通用问题类型泛化性能度量应涵盖MODP算法常见的目标类型:*多目标:算法是否能够在多个目标函数上取得相似的性能?*非连续性:算法是否能够处理目标函数中非连续的区域?*高维性:算法是否能够解决高维问题空间?*动态性:算法是否能够适应环境变化和用户交互?度量标准类别根据评估目标,泛化性能度量标准可分为以下类别:*平均帕累托距离(APD):测量算法生成的帕累托前沿与真实帕累托前沿之间的平均距离。*超体积覆盖率(HV):衡量算法生成的帕累托前沿覆盖目标空间超体积的程度。*多目标指标(MOP):综合考虑APD和HV等多项指标,提供综合性能评估。*后悔值:测量决策者在不同决策下的累计目标值与最优目标值之间的差值。*斯特林值(SV):评估基于经验的决策策略的泛化性能,考虑决策的稳健性和鲁棒性。*多标准在线性能指标(MSOPI):将在线regret和SV等度量与其他指标相结合,提供更全面的评估。7/-在线混合度量*动态下限(DL):离线计算算法在各种动态环境下的最优下限,用于与在线决策策略进行比较。*综合动态评价指标(CDEI):综合考虑离线和在线度量,评估算法在动态环境下的适应性。度量标准选择选择最合适的度量标准取决于具体问题的目标和特征。以下是一些考虑因素:*目标函数类型:连续或离散、凸或非凸。*环境动态性:静态或动态、确定性或不确定性。*决策周期:离线(单次决策)或在线(连续决策)。*计算复杂度:度量计算的复杂度和可扩展性。标准化和基准测试为了确保公平比较,泛化性能度量应标准化并建立基准测试。这包括:*基准算法:使用已知性能的算法作为基准。*统一问题集:使用一组标准化问题来评估算法。*统计分析:使用统计检验(如t检验或ANOVA)来确定算法之间的显著差异。通过制定合适的泛化性能度量标准,我们可以定量评估MODP算法的适应性,促进算法的开发和应用。9/30第三部分泛化性能定量化方法分析关键词关键要点主题名称:,反映了算法对未知数据分布的适应能力。,包括平均绝对误差(MAE)、均方误差(MSE)和相对误差等。,它应与实际应用场景和目标相关。主题名称:泛化性能定量化方法泛化性能定量化方法分析多目标动态规划算法(MODP)的泛化性能定量化是指评估算法在不同任务和环境中的鲁棒性和适应能力。泛化性能良好的算法可以在广泛的问题域中保持有效,即使这些问题域与训练数据不同。本文介绍了用于量化MODP泛化性能的几种方法::交叉验证将数据集分成多个子集,每个子集用作测试集,其余子集用作训练集。该过程重复执行多次,每个子集都用作测试集。泛化性能通过计算所有测试集上的平均误差来定量化。:保持验证类似于交叉验证,但它将数据集分成训练集和测试集。训练集用于训练算法,而测试集用于评估其泛化性能。泛化性能通过计算测试集上的误差来定量化。:泛化度量是专门设计用来评估MODP泛化性能的指标。它们通常基于以下原则:

多目标动态规划算法的泛化性能定量化 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数24
  • 收藏数0 收藏
  • 顶次数0
  • 上传人科技星球
  • 文件大小41 KB
  • 时间2024-03-27